The Latest! OECD Revises Indonesia's Economic Growth Projection to 4.9%
The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development (OECD) has raised its outlook for Indonesia’s economy, projecting growth of 4.9% for both 2025 and 2026. This marks an improvement from its previous forecast, reflecting growing optimism about Indonesia’s economic resilience and recovery. The OECD attributed this upward revision to several positive…
At the United Nations, Prabowo Stated that Indonesia is Self-Sufficient in Food and Ready to Export Rice
During his speech at the 80th United Nations General Assembly in New York on 23 September 2025, President Prabowo Subianto claimed that Indonesia has achieved food self-sufficiency, particularly in rice production. He proudly announced that this year, Indonesia reached its highest level of rice production and the largest stockpile of…
OECD Projects Italy’s GDP Growth at 0.6% in 2025 and 2026
According to the OECD's latest Economic Outlook report released on Tuesday, Italy's GDP is projected to grow by 0.6% this year and in 2026, following a 0.7% expansion last year. The forecast for this year remains unchanged from the June outlook, but the prediction for next year has been revised…
Indonesia Prepares Measures to Ease Global Minimum Tax Burden for Investors
Indonesia is preparing non-fiscal incentives to mitigate the impact of the 15% global minimum tax (GMT) on large corporations and maintain its competitiveness in attracting foreign investment. The GMT, adopted by more than 130 countries, seeks to prevent profit shifting to low-tax jurisdictions and applies to multinationals with global revenues…
